FAQ
What is the barrel twist rate for the 6.5 Weatherby RPM?
The factory barrel uses a 1:8” twist rate, which stabilizes 140-grain bullets perfectly and handles up to 156-grain Berger hybrids for long-range work.
Does the Accubrake ST come pre-installed?
Yes, the muzzle brake is factory-installed and timed. You can remove it with a standard wrench if you need to suppress the rifle, but the brake is optimized for the 6.5 RPM’s recoil impulse.
Can I mount a bipod to the Peak 44 stock?
The stock has two flush-cup sling swivel studs, but no integrated Arca or Picatinny rail. You’ll need to add an aftermarket rail or use a bipod that attaches to the studs. Many PRS shooters add an MDT Arca rail to the bottom.
Is the action compatible with Remington 700 scope bases?
No. The Mark V Apex uses a proprietary footprint. Weatherby offers direct-mount rings, but you can also use a one-piece base designed for the Mark V action. Check with your optics mount manufacturer for compatibility.
What is the magazine capacity?
The rifle ships with a detachable box magazine holding 4 rounds. You can also load a single round directly into the chamber for a 4+1 capacity.
